Chinese aircraft carrier programme
As of 2024, the Chinese People''s Liberation Army Navy (PLAN) has two active carriers, the Liaoning and Shandong, with the third, Fujian, currently undergoing sea trials. Chinese aircraft carrier Liaoning
Liaoning (16; Chinese: ; pinyin: Liáoníng Jiàn) is a Chinese Type 001 aircraft carrier.The first aircraft carrier commissioned into the People''s Liberation Army Navy Surface Force, she was originally classified as a training ship, intended to allow the Navy to experiment, train and gain familiarity with aircraft carrier operations.. Navy''s EMALS Launch Technology Passes Critical 18-Month Test
The EMALS system, in development as far back as 2000 with General Atomics Electromagnetic Systems, consists of a series of transformers and rectifiers designed to convert and store electrical power through motor-generators before bringing power to the launch motors on the ship''s catapults.. Chinese aircraft carrier Fujian
Fujian (18; Chinese: ; pinyin: Fújiàn Jiàn), named after Fujian province, is a Chinese aircraft carrier serving in the People''s Liberation Army Navy is the third aircraft carrier of the Chinese aircraft carrier programme and the first of the Type 003 class (NATO/OSD Fujian class). A look at China''s new Type 002 ''Shandong'' aircraft carrier
The commissioning into service of China''s first domestically constructed aircraft carrier on the 17th of December 2019 marked a momentous paradigm shift, not only in the Chinese People''s Liberation Army Navy''s (PLAN''s) strategic philosophy, but it also introduced a new and important participant into the areas of carrier construction and operation.

The Liaoning and CV-17: A Look at China''s Type 001A Carrier Force
Recently, there has been much ado about China''s aircraft carriers. CV-16, known as the Liaoning, was launched in 2012 to much fanfare, and CV-17 will probably enter service within a few years. Until this point, China''s People''s Liberation Army Navy (PLAN) had not operated any carriers.
